I will simply point you to the iTerm2 AI kerfuffle (https://news.ycombinator.com/item?id=40458135) as proof that some in open source _are_ in a mad rush to bolt on completely unnecessary "features".
It was a bad choice that never should have been implemented as "enabled but not configured", and I have moved away from iTerm2 as a result. I am sure that others have as well. (The grudging move to make it a separately downloadable plugin was good, but too late IMO.)